Best Red Bud Area Public Middle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 826 students in the neighborhood of Red Bud Area, Abilene, TX.
The top-ranked public middle school in Red Bud Area is Madison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Red Bud Area, Abilene, TX public middle school have an average math proficiency score of 30% (versus the Texas public middle school average of 43%), and reading proficiency score of 29% (versus the 52%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 57%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Texas public middle school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
